离线作业答案 发表于 2017-5-3 15:43:29

西南交17春《软件工程》在线作业一二答案

西南交《软件工程》在线作业一

一、单选题:
1.软件需求分析阶段建立原型的主要目的时(    )          (满分:4)
    A. 确定系统的功能和性能要求
    B. 确定系统的运行要求
    C. 确定系统是否满足用户需要
    D. 确定系统是否满足开发人员需要
2.好的软件结构应该是(    )          (满分:4)
    A. 高内聚、高耦合
    B. 低耦合、高内聚
    C. 高耦合、低内聚
    D. 低耦合、低内聚
3.软件工程学科出现的直接原因是(    )          (满分:4)
    A. 计算机的发展
    B. 其它工程学科的影响
    C. 软件危机的出现
    D. 程序设计方法学的影响
4.(    )着重反映的是模块间的隶属关系,即模块间的调用关系和层次关系          (满分:4)
    A. 程序流程图
    B. 数据流图
    C. E-R图
    D. 软件结构图
5.(    )是数据说明、可执行语句等程序对象的集合,它是单独命名的而且可通过名字访问          (满分:4)
    A. 模块化
    B. 抽象
    C. 精化
    D. 模块
6.软件设计阶段一般又可分为(    )          (满分:4)
    A. 逻辑设计和功能设计
    B. 概要设计和详细设计
    C. 概念设计和物理设计
    D. 模型设计和程序设计
7.软件工程与计算机科学的性质不同,软件工程着重于(    )          (满分:4)
    A. 理论研究
    B. 建造软件系统
    C. 原理探讨
    D. 原理的理论
8.在软件的可行性研究主要从不同角度对系统进行可行性研究,其中从功能角度对系统进行研究属于(    )的研究          (满分:4)
    A. 经济可行性
    B. 技术可行性
    C. 操作可行性
    D. 社会可行性
9.软件设计中划分模块通常遵循的原则是要使模块间的耦合性尽可能(    )          (满分:4)
    A. 强
    B. 弱
    C. 较强
    D. 适中
10.通过(    )分解完成数据流图的细化          (满分:4)
    A. 结构分解
    B. 功能分解
    C. 数据分解
    D. 系统分解
11.数据字典不包括的条目是(    )          (满分:4)
    A. 数据项
    B. 数据流
    C. 数据类型
    D. 数据加工
12.需求分析阶段最重要的技术文档之一是(    )          (满分:4)
    A. 项目开发计划
    B. 设计说明书
    C. 需求规格说明书
    D. 可行性分析报告
13.制定软件项目开发计划的目的对软件开发过程、进度、资源进行(    )          (满分:4)
    A. 组织和管理
    B. 分析与估算
    C. 设计与测试
    D. 规划与调整
14.在结构化分析方法中,与数据流图配合使用的是(    )          (满分:4)
    A. 网络图
    B. 实体联系图
    C. 数据字典
    D. 程序流程图
15.软件生成周期模型有多种,下列选项中,【   】不是软件生存周期模型          (满分:4)
    A. 螺旋模型
    B. 增量模型
    C. 功能模型
    D. 瀑布模型
16.一个模块把数值作为参数传递给另一个模块,这种耦合方式称为(    )          (满分:4)
    A. 公共耦合
    B. 内容耦合
    C. 控制耦合
    D. 数据耦合
17.软件需求规格说明书的内容不应包括对(    )的描述          (满分:4)
    A. 主要功能
    B. 算法的详细过程
    C. 用户界面及运行环境
    D. 软件的性能
18.内聚是对模块功能强度的度量,内聚性最强的是(    )          (满分:4)
    A. 逻辑内聚
    B. 顺序内聚
    C. 偶然内聚
    D. 功能内聚
19.与计算机科学的理论研究不同,软件工程是一门(    )的学科          (满分:4)
    A. 理论性
    B. 工程性
    C. 原理性
    D. 心理性
20.程序结构中矩形表示(    )          (满分:4)
    A. 数据
    B. 加工
    C. 模块
    D. 存储
21.由于软件生产的复杂性和高成本,使大型软件的生成出现危机,软件危机的主要表现包括了下述(    )方面。①生产成本过高②需求增长难以满足③进度难以控制④质量难以保证          (满分:4)
    A. ①②
    B. ②③
    C. ④
    D. 全部
22.下列不属于成本-效益分析的度量指标是(    )          (满分:4)
    A. 货币的时间价值
    B. 投资回收期
    C. 性质因素
    D. 纯收入
23.在需求分析之前有必要进行(    )          (满分:4)
    A. 程序设计
    B. 可行性分析
    C. ER分析
    D. 3NF分析
24.结构化分析方法使用的描述工具(    )定义了数据流图中每一个图形元素          (满分:4)
    A. 数据流图
    B. 数据字典
    C. 判定表
    D. 判定树
25.结构化设计又称为(    )          (满分:4)
    A. 概要设计
    B. 面向数据流设计
    C. 面向对象设计
    D. 详细设计

西南交《软件工程》在线作业二

一、单选题:
1.数据流图描述系统的(    )          (满分:4)
    A. 数据结构
    B. 控制流程
    C. 基本加工
    D. 软件功能
2.软件设计中划分模块通常遵循的原则是要使模块间的耦合性尽可能(    )          (满分:4)
    A. 强
    B. 弱
    C. 较强
    D. 适中
3.内聚是对模块功能强度的度量,内聚性最强的是(    )          (满分:4)
    A. 逻辑内聚
    B. 顺序内聚
    C. 偶然内聚
    D. 功能内聚
4.最高程度也是最差的耦合是(    )          (满分:4)
    A. 公共耦合
    B. 内容耦合
    C. 控制耦合
    D. 数据耦合
5.程序结构中矩形表示(    )          (满分:4)
    A. 数据
    B. 加工
    C. 模块
    D. 存储
6.由于软件生产的复杂性和高成本,使大型软件的生成出现危机,软件危机的主要表现包括了下述(    )方面。①生产成本过高②需求增长难以满足③进度难以控制④质量难以保证          (满分:4)
    A. ①②
    B. ②③
    C. ④
    D. 全部
7.软件工程与计算机科学的性质不同,软件工程着重于(    )          (满分:4)
    A. 理论研究
    B. 建造软件系统
    C. 原理探讨
    D. 原理的理论
8.SA方法的基本思想是(    )          (满分:4)
    A. 自底向上逐步抽象
    B. 自底向上逐步分解
    C. 自顶向下逐步分解
    D. 自顶向下逐步抽象
9.制定软件项目开发计划的目的对软件开发过程、进度、资源进行(    )          (满分:4)
    A. 组织和管理
    B. 分析与估算
    C. 设计与测试
    D. 规划与调整
10.一个模块把数值作为参数传递给另一个模块,这种耦合方式称为(    )          (满分:4)
    A. 公共耦合
    B. 内容耦合
    C. 控制耦合
    D. 数据耦合
11.数据字典不包括的条目是(    )          (满分:4)
    A. 数据项
    B. 数据流
    C. 数据类型
    D. 数据加工
12.需求规格说明书的作用不应包括(    )          (满分:4)
    A. 软件设计的依据
    B. 用户与开发人员对软件要做什么的共同理解
    C. 软件验收的依据
    D. 软件可行性研究的依据
13.软件设计一般分为总体设计和详细设计,它们之间的关系是(    )          (满分:4)
    A. 全局和局部
    B. 抽象和具体
    C. 总体和层次
    D. 功能和结构
14.软件需求规格说明书的内容不应包括对(    )的描述          (满分:4)
    A. 主要功能
    B. 算法的详细过程
    C. 用户界面及运行环境
    D. 软件的性能
15.与计算机科学的理论研究不同,软件工程是一门(    )的学科          (满分:4)
    A. 理论性
    B. 工程性
    C. 原理性
    D. 心理性
16.软件生成周期模型有多种,下列选项中,【   】不是软件生存周期模型          (满分:4)
    A. 螺旋模型
    B. 增量模型
    C. 功能模型
    D. 瀑布模型
17.需求分析阶段的研究对象是(    )          (满分:4)
    A. 用户要求
    B. 分析员要求
    C. 系统要求
    D. 软硬件要求
18.属于软件设计的基本原理是(    )。          (满分:4)
    A. 数据流分析设计
    B. 变换流分析设计
    C. 事务流分析设计
    D. 模块化
19.在数据流图中,有名字及方向的成分是(    )          (满分:4)
    A. 数据流
    B. 信息流
    C. 控制流
    D. 信号流
20.在结构化分析方法中,与数据流图配合使用的是(    )          (满分:4)
    A. 网络图
    B. 实体联系图
    C. 数据字典
    D. 程序流程图
21.软件是一种(    )性工业产品          (满分:4)
    A. 理论
    B. 知识(或逻辑)
    C. 消耗
    D. 体力
22.软件工程学科出现的直接原因是(    )          (满分:4)
    A. 计算机的发展
    B. 其它工程学科的影响
    C. 软件危机的出现
    D. 程序设计方法学的影响
23.结构化设计又称为(    )          (满分:4)
    A. 概要设计
    B. 面向数据流设计
    C. 面向对象设计
    D. 详细设计
24.在软件的可行性研究主要从不同角度对系统进行可行性研究,其中从功能角度对系统进行研究属于(    )的研究          (满分:4)
    A. 经济可行性
    B. 技术可行性
    C. 操作可行性
    D. 社会可行性
25.结构化分析方法使用的描述工具(    )定义了数据流图中每一个图形元素          (满分:4)
    A. 数据流图
    B. 数据字典
    C. 判定表
    D. 判定树

诸葛鱼虾 发表于 2017-5-8 20:18:25

在做作业,求解题参考资料。
页: [1]
查看完整版本: 西南交17春《软件工程》在线作业一二答案